It's just an update; I don't think they meant it to be a huge upgrade for people who already own the iD14. My favorite new feature is the USB-C connector, which provides enough power to no longer need the wall wart. (I don't need phantom power most of the time, so almost every time I plug in a condenser mic I end up puzzled for a few minutes about why it won't work.) The mkII also has an additional pair of analog outputs and a second headphone jack.

To control them independently you'd need a separate headphone amplifier for the second set of headphones. The unit can create separate mixes with separate levels, but one output will be via the monitor output, which will require an amp to boost it up. I use the Rolls PM50se for this kind of thing. Works well and very affordable.
